Depends on what you're talking about: EDM (electronic dance music) or techno?

EDM is the entire genre, which includes trance, house, techno, breakbeat, and a ton of other subgenres. EDM is huge in the United States these days, almost as much as in Europe. Trance and house shows sell out regularly and have crowds of 50,000 people in big stadiums. Most people call EDM "techno" in the USA, and that's not right, as techno is a specific subgenre and really sounds nothing like house or trance.
